Expression for rate law for first order kinetics is given by:
![t=\frac{2.303}{k}\log\frac{a}{a-x}](https://tex.z-dn.net/?f=t%3D%5Cfrac%7B2.303%7D%7Bk%7D%5Clog%5Cfrac%7Ba%7D%7Ba-x%7D)
where,
k = rate constant
t = age of sample
a = initial amount of the reactant = 800
x = amount of daughter isotope = 600
a - x = amount left after decay process = amount of parent isotope = (800-600) = 200
Half life is the amount of time taken by a radioactive material to decay to half of its original value.
![t_{\frac{1}{2}}=\frac{0.693}{k}](https://tex.z-dn.net/?f=t_%7B%5Cfrac%7B1%7D%7B2%7D%7D%3D%5Cfrac%7B0.693%7D%7Bk%7D)
![k=\frac{0.693}{1000000}=0.000000693years^{-1}](https://tex.z-dn.net/?f=k%3D%5Cfrac%7B0.693%7D%7B1000000%7D%3D0.000000693years%5E%7B-1%7D)
![t=\frac{2.303}{0.000000693}\log\frac{800}{200}](https://tex.z-dn.net/?f=t%3D%5Cfrac%7B2.303%7D%7B0.000000693%7D%5Clog%5Cfrac%7B800%7D%7B200%7D)
![t=2000785years](https://tex.z-dn.net/?f=t%3D2000785years)
The rock is 2000785 years old.
